About this route:
A direct, nonstop flight between Ellsworth Air Force Base (RCA), Rapid City, South Dakota, United States and Gdansk Lech Walesa Airport (GDN), Gdańsk, Poland would travel a Great Circle distance of 4,813 miles (or 7,746 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Ellsworth Air Force Base and Gdansk Lech Walesa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Ellsworth Air Force Base (RCA):
- Ellsworth AFB was established in 1941 as Rapid City Army Air Base.
- The furthest airport from Ellsworth Air Force Base (RCA) is Sir Gaëtan Duval Airport (RRG), which is located 10,579 miles (17,026 kilometers) away in Rodrigues Island, Mauritius.
- The airfield was again temporarily shut down from September 1946 – March 1947 and underwent a major construction program to upgrade the temporary wartime facilities to that of a permanent base.
- An AN/MPS-14 height-finder radar was added in 1956.
- In addition to being known as "Ellsworth Air Force Base", another name for RCA is "Ellsworth AFB".
- Rapid City AAB was reactivated on 11 October 1945 and was assigned to Continental Air Force.
- The closest airport to Ellsworth Air Force Base (RCA) is Rapid City Regional Airport (RAP), which is located only 7 miles (11 kilometers) S of RCA.
- In 1986, the base and the 28 BMW made extensive preparations to phase out the aging B-52 fleet and become the second home for the advanced B-1B Lancer.
Facts about Gdansk Lech Walesa Airport (GDN):
- The furthest airport from Gdansk Lech Walesa Airport (GDN) is Chatham Islands (CHT), which is located 11,446 miles (18,421 kilometers) away in Waitangi, Chatham Islands, New Zealand.
- Gdansk Lech Walesa Airport (GDN) currently has only 1 runway.
- In addition to being known as "Gdansk Lech Walesa Airport", other names for GDN include "Port Lotniczy Gdańsk im. Lecha Wałęsy" and "Gdańsk".
- The closest airport to Gdansk Lech Walesa Airport (GDN) is Gdynia-Kosakowo Airport (QYD), which is located only 14 miles (23 kilometers) N of GDN.
- In 2006 it served 1,249,780 passengers.
- Because of Gdansk Lech Walesa Airport's relatively low elevation of 489 feet, planes can take off or land at Gdansk Lech Walesa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
